Elevating Product Packaging and Label Hierarchy
In the context of physical goods, packaging design serves as the silent salesperson. When I integrated Blessed Floral Faith Typography into our candle jar labels, it immediately solved a visual hierarchy problem. The hand-lettered "Blessed" script acted as a secondary headline, drawing the eye without competing with the primary product name or scent description. This is crucial for handmade business owners who often struggle to make their product labels look polished rather than cluttered. The delicate botanical line art provided a framing device that softened the rigid edges of the label die-cut, making the packaging feel bespoke and high-end.
For food businesses or boutique stores, this graphic design asset works exceptionally well as a seal of quality or a decorative accent on hang tags. It communicates care and craftsmanship before the customer even reads the ingredients list. However, practical application requires testing. I strongly recommend previewing this asset on actual product mockups at 100% scale. What looks airy on a screen can become illegible on a two-inch cosmetic jar. Ensure the intricate lines of the botanical illustration hold up when printed on textured paper or kraft stock, as fine details can sometimes get lost in commercial printing processes.

Navigating Limitations and Technical Considerations
No single graphic design asset is a universal solution. Professional branding requires knowing when not to use an element. Blessed Floral Faith Typography should be used with extreme caution in formal corporate branding or luxury minimalist contexts where stark geometry is preferred over organic forms. Furthermore, avoid placing this detailed illustration in areas dense with legal text or ingredient lists. The decorative nature of the botanical line art can reduce readability if it competes with mandatory compliance information.
From a technical standpoint, always verify the file formats included in your download. For packaging design and large-format printing, SVG design files are non-negotiable to ensure crisp edges at any size. If you are only provided with PNG design files, check the resolution (minimum 300 DPI) and transparency quality. Before finalizing any commercial design, confirm the commercial license terms. Many creative marketplace assets restrict usage for physical product sales or require attribution. Protecting your business means ensuring you have full rights to use the clipart and illustration in your specific jurisdiction and industry.
